> I have a mesh file where I defined a physical group named "volume" whose
> id is 0.
>
> For DMPlex, I know that I can use this id (0) to access this physical
> group. Here I would like to ask that is it possible to use the physical
> group name "volume" to achieve this in DMPlex. Thank you very much.
>
> Do you mean the $PhysicalNames section in a GMsh file? No, right now we
ignore those names. We could maintain a
translation table in the DM between the names and integers, but it seemed
to specialized to GMsh. We are willing to
listen to arguments however.
